public JsonResult DeleteDB(int DatatabseID) { try { var database = new QueryDBAppEntities1(); EPIDatabases dbDetail = database.EPIDatabases.Find(DatatabseID); database.EPIDatabases.Remove(dbDetail); database.SaveChanges(); return(Json(new { Result = "OK" })); } catch (Exception ex) { return(Json(new { Result = "ERROR", Message = ex.Message })); } }
public JsonResult UpdateDB(EPIDatabases DBModel) { try { if (!ModelState.IsValid) { return(Json(new { Result = "ERROR", Message = "Form is not valid! Please correct it and try again." })); } var database = new QueryDBAppEntities1(); database.Entry(DBModel).State = EntityState.Modified; database.SaveChanges(); return(Json(new { Result = "OK" })); } catch (Exception ex) { return(Json(new { Result = "ERROR", Message = ex.Message })); } }
public JsonResult CreateDB(EPIDatabases DBModel) { try { if (!ModelState.IsValid) { return(Json(new { Result = "ERROR", Message = "Form is not valid! Please correct it and try again." })); } var database = new QueryDBAppEntities1(); database.EPIDatabases.Add(DBModel); database.SaveChanges(); return(Json(new { Result = "OK", Record = DBModel }, JsonRequestBehavior.AllowGet)); } catch (Exception ex) { return(Json(new { Result = "ERROR", Message = ex.Message })); } }